From the Decline of Guilds Through the Eighteenth Century

  • Ross D. Petty

摘要

As the use of guild marks declined, the use of masters’ marks became more popular and were supported by commercial tribunals. Furthermore, merchants often sought some sort of royal charter or endorsement to help distinguish their goods from others. However law courts were reluctant in supporting such commercial marks and in the case of proprietary medicines, often used poor quality as justification.
